    If you already checked the location, you might already know that: - The views from La Scala Fenicia are amazing. The final stop,Villa San Michele, is not the only and most interesting spot. - Mount Solaro is a must a. the chairlift is the easiest option b. or just go for a nice hike as it's not challenging. On you way down to Anacapri take in the beautiful scenery from Santa Maria a Cetrella and appreciate the stunning Faraglioni cliffs. - You can get to Capri via La Scala Fenicia and then taking one of the pedestrian streets - it's a beautiful 35 minute walk, but this is not for everybody. If you don't want to wait for half an hour for the bus, you can go for this option. - Faro di Punta Carena Take the bus and go for a dive. There is a nice beach, and I would rather spend my time there swimming/diving, instead of waiting for 2 hours in the line for Blue grotto. The emerald crystal water is full of fish playing around the rocks :) Last, but not leas. Capri is pretty, but it looks a bit like an outdoor mall. Anacapri on the other hand is way more interesting and has a authentic vibe and most of the stunning views and trails are right here.

    Absolutely lovely. Great restaurants/cafes/bars. Lovely shops including jewellery and shoes made on site. The most amazing lemons grown and sold here. Lovely churches and amazing squares where locals gather and children happily play. Great bus service to harbour, beach and down to Capri. Chair lift with view over all of Capri. Winter home of actress/wartime singer Gracie Fields.
